Transaction 4579a5a27c00a5f0158a5d44d263f78ec46ec916314e5c834c0b442045297cfb
1 Input
1 Outputs
- 4579a5a27c00a5f0158a5d44d263f78ec46ec916314e5c834c0b442045297cfb:0
value 1164089
address 3Py4XDTgaBE625DtLfEqbAQwiaZUcTekcS